DESCRIPTION (Adapted from the applicant's abstract): This proposal will
characterize the postnatal development of the genioglossal and phrenic
motoneurons, by correlating physiological changes in membrane
conductance and spiking properties with changes in anatomy. The strength
of respiratory muscle contraction is determined by the number of
respiratory motoneurons activated and their rate of discharge. Both the
order in which the neurons are activated and their discharge rates are
a function of their resting conductance, that is, the number of membrane
channels open at any given time. Most membrane channels are controlled
by neurotransmitters and/or by the intrinsic electrical state of the
cell membrane. The change in the balance of these two processes are most
dramatic during postnatal development. The applicant is interested in
these processes that occur in the two respiratory motoneurons that
affect the performance of the diaphragm and genioglossus. Activation of
these two muscles must be coordinated to move air into the lungs with
the least effort; this may be particularly relevant to the
pathophysiology of Sudden Infant Death Syndrome (SIDS). In the past
period, the applicant established that glycine significantly contributed
to the increase in resting membrane conductance that occurs at 3 weeks,
and that these age-related increases in resting conductance result from
an increase in the number of open potassium channels. The proposed
studies will be performed on genioglossal and phrenic motoneurons in
slice preparations of the rat brainstem and spinal cord. Visually
identified motoneurons will be studied from four different age groups
(1-2, 5-7, 13-15 and 19-22 days) with a combination of patch-clamp
recording, three-dimensional neuronal reconstruction and
immunocytochemical localization of certain receptors and ion channels.
The application will: 1) examine the anatomy and physiology of glycine,
GABA, and glutamate neurotransmitter systems at the four stages during
postnatal development; 2) identify specific potassium channels that
contribute to the increase in membrane conductance and spike
characteristics; and 3) explore the intracellular pathways mediating the
enhanced potassium conductance.
